A great juror in a federal proceedings in connection with the Karen Read case in a suburb of Boston was accused of having made confidential information about hearings.

Jessica Leslie has already approved a plea contract that contains a one -day prison sentence for which she is credited to the time after court documents and two -year probation workers, as court records.

The case was submitted on July 11th and she signed the plea three days later.

According to the state prosecutor, Leslie leaked details from May 26, 2022, and the Grand jury said goodbye to several people – the names of witnesses who appeared in front of the committee, prove details of their certificates and others that were under seal.

The recipients of the leaks were not identified in court documents.

While the submissions do not specifically identify the case, Leslie was a great juror where a source near the investigation of the FOX News was confirmed that it was related to Karen Read.

Read's first legal proceedings for murder, drunken driving and escape from the place of a deadly accident ended last year with a crashed jury. A second attempt solved her from the most serious charges.
